Material plays a vital role in determining the price of a medicine trolley. Most trolleys are made from stainless steel, plastic, or a combination of both. Stainless steel trolleys tend to be more expensive due to their durability, resistance to corrosion, and ease of cleaning, making them suitable for environments where hygiene is paramount. On the other hand, plastic trolleys are lighter and more affordable, although they may not withstand wear and tear as effectively as their metal counterparts.
One of the primary concerns for individuals with limited mobility is the risk of slips and falls in the bathroom. Wet surfaces can be hazardous, making it difficult for those who rely on assistive devices. Shower chairs equipped with safety belts provide an additional layer of security. The safety belt helps to secure the user in place, preventing them from sliding off or losing balance. This feature is especially crucial in maintaining the dignity and safety of users, allowing them to bathe without the constant worry of falling.

Attendant controlled electric power wheelchairs represent a significant advancement in mobility technology, catering specifically to individuals with disabilities who require both independence and assistance. These sophisticated devices are designed to be operated primarily by an attendant, enabling care providers to navigate the wheelchair while ensuring the safety and comfort of the user. This combination of autonomy and support addresses the unique needs of many individuals with limited mobility.
